Position Summary:

The General Counsel serves as the chief legal advisor to the organization and is responsible for overseeing all legal, regulatory, compliance, privacy, and risk management matters affecting UCH. This role is a member of the UCH Executive team and provides strategic legal guidance to executive, physician and operational leadership, manages outside counsel, and serves as the organization's designated Compliance and Privacy Officer under HIPAA.

The General Counsel & Privacy Officer helps ensure the organization operates in compliance with applicable federal and state laws, healthcare regulations, payer requirements, and industry best practices while supporting business growth, physician alignment, and operational excellence.


Key Results Areas (KRAs):

· Serves as the principal legal advisor to the CEO, executive leadership team, Board of Directors, and affiliated entities. Provides practical, business-oriented legal advice that supports organizational objectives.

· Supports governance activities for UCH and affiliated entities, including the preparation of board resolutions, corporate records, and governance documents. 

· Provides counsel regarding all applicable federal and state healthcare laws and regulations, as well as state licensing, professional practice requirements, and provider enrollment/reimbursement matters. 

· Serves as the UCH Compliance Officer, and leads regulatory investigations, audits, and inquiries.  Develops and implements policies and procedures for the Corporate and Billing Compliance programs to prevent illegal, unethical or improper conduct. 

· Serves as UCH Privacy Officer, and develops and implements privacy policies and procedures in accordance with all applicable laws and regulations. Investigates potential privacy breaches, and coordinates breach response activities. 

· Manages Health Information Management services, and oversees patient rights requests. 

· Coordinates all UCH compliance and privacy training and awareness programs and efforts.

· Manages the UCH Contract Management Database, and drafts and reviews corporate agreements, contracts, leases, and payer agreements. 

· Directs all litigation and outside counsel, and manages legal budget and spend. Directs responses to subpoenas, government inquiries, and administrative proceedings, as well as advises Human Resources regarding applicable employment and labor law. 

· Oversees UCH incident reporting, professional liability matters, and corporate insurance coverage to ensure UCH’s interests are protected.

Education & Experience:

· Juris Doctor (J.D.) degree from accredited law school required.

· Active license in good standing to practice law in the State of Tennessee.

· 10 years of progressively responsible legal experience required. Experience supporting physician practices or health systems strongly preferred. 

· Experience serving as a Privacy Officer and leading privacy compliance initiatives strongly preferred. 

· Experience with physician transactions, employment matters, and healthcare regulatory compliance strongly preferred.

· Deep understanding of healthcare regulatory and reimbursement environments. 

· Strong knowledge of HIPAA, HITECH, Stark Law, Anti-Kickback Statute, and healthcare fraud and abuse laws. 

· Demonstrated expertise in contract negotiation and drafting.
